Building Eternal Tattoo Shop’s reputation is all that matters to owner Theo Jenkins… until the janitorial company sends Serena Falco, a shy part-time maid who's about to throw off all of his carefully laid plans.

Theo

My reputation is hardworking. No BS. Tattooing saved my life. Became my life. I've worked hard to become a top black and gray tattoo artist and finally opening my own shop is a dream come true. Everything’s going according to plan, until… Serena shows up. I’d figured the janitorial company would send a quiet, middle-aged guy who’d be in and out every week. Not an irresistibly curvy -and clumsy -undeniable stunner of a maid. Now, I’m faced with the sweetest forbidden distraction to make me question everything.

Serena

I’m used to cleaning churches, community centers, and the occasional house on the market. Not tattoo parlors. I’ve quite literally never stepped foot in one until my employer assigns me to Eternal Tattoo Shop. To my horror, I'm so nervous that I end up breaking some very expensive equipment on my first day there. Miraculously, the British silver fox of an owner takes pity on me and lets me work it off instead of paying the bill I can’t afford. Soon, I realize I’m in way over my head. Working some extra hours for Theo is one thing, but falling for him is another…

Two things are eternal: love and ink. Welcome to Eternal Tattoo Shop, where ink plays cupid in each steamy, standalone instalove novella. Serena and Theo’s story is an alpha male/nerdy curvy woman boss/employee age-gap romance with no cliffhangers, no cheating, and HEA. (Epilogue included!)
